#include <stdio.h>
#include <stdint.h>
void sort_array(uint8_t *arr, uint8_t n) {
// Sort in ascending order
// [2 3 5 7 10]
for (uint8_t i = 0; i < n -1; i++) {
uint8_t swapped = 0;
for (uint8_t j =0; j < n -1 - i; j++) {
if (arr[j] > arr[j+1]) {
uint8_t tmp = arr[j];
arr[j] = arr[j + 1];
arr[j+1] = tmp;
swapped = 1;
}
}
if (!swapped) break;
}
}
void find_kth_elements(uint8_t *arr, uint8_t n, uint8_t k, uint8_t *smallest, uint8_t *largest) {
// Your logic here
sort_array(arr,n);
*smallest = arr[k - 1];
*largest = arr[n-k];
}
int main() {
uint8_t n, k;
scanf("%hhu", &n);
uint8_t arr[100];
for (uint8_t i = 0; i < n; i++) {
scanf("%hhu", &arr[i]);
}
scanf("%hhu", &k);
uint8_t smallest, largest;
find_kth_elements(arr, n, k, &smallest, &largest);
printf("%hhu %hhu", smallest, largest);
return 0;
}
Input
5 10 3 5 2 7 2
Expected Output
3 7
